Title: Jeong-Ho Park: Innovator in Plasma Air Dust Collection Technology
Introduction: Jeong-Ho Park is a prominent inventor based in Busan, South Korea, known for his innovative contributions in the field of air dust collection technologies. With a focus on improving air quality, he developed a pioneering invention that has garnered attention in the industry.
Latest Patents: Jeong-Ho Park holds a patent for his invention titled "Plasma Air Dust Collector." This advanced device features a first electrode fixing unit and a second electrode fixing unit, each equipped with a power terminal. It incorporates at least two dust collecting electrodes and a discharge electrode strategically arranged between them. Additionally, the design includes terminal protrusions at the bottom end of each dust collecting electrode, terminal protrusion insertion holes located on the first electrode fixing unit, combining protrusions, and combining grooves at both ends of the dust collecting electrodes.
